Action item: The Relayn deploy-status bot silently dropped updates when the pipeline API paginated results, so responders believed a rollback had completed when it had not. We will add pagination handling, a staleness banner, and an integration test. Until merged, verify deploy state directly in the pipeline console, documented at the page below.

runbook for kahop-kajop: https://rundeck.ordinio.test/display/secrets/pipeline/issue/pages/repo/browse/e5732776e07d1285107e5aeb

## Changelog — 3.2.0: Firmware channel defaults changed

The Brindlecote device fleet's firmware update channel now defaults to the signed "stable-verified" track instead of "stable". Devices on the old track will not auto-migrate; a one-time channel switch is pushed on next check-in, and the switch itself is signed with the Halveston release key. Unsigned payloads are rejected at the device, not just the relay. For the reviewer's reference, the new default channel configuration is listed below.

config for tagep-yajef:
ulawyn:
  log_level: error
  metrics_host: metrics.ulawyn.lumiclabs.internal
  pin: 0564
  pool_size: 32

Fan-out backpressure for the Quillet notifier: when the queue depth crosses the soft limit, the dispatcher sheds low-priority pushes and batches the rest at 500ms intervals. Reviewer should confirm the shed counter is exported and that retries respect the jitter window. Once merged, the release artifact gets re-signed by the pipeline, which expects the deploy key shown below.

deploy key for bawep-yawif: bky6_GQhaSt

Vendor note — Brightlane admin dashboard

Quick heads-up for reviewers: the dark-mode work from our vendor, Tindervale Studio, lands in three PRs this sprint. They're using our token system rather than hardcoded colors, which is great, but please check contrast ratios on the tables — their first pass missed a few. Flag anything off-palette rather than fixing it yourself; it goes back to them under contract. Vendor questions go to their delivery lead.

escalation mailbox, yafog-kafof: eliok@xolmarcloud.local